In the automotive industry, rocker potentiometers play a critical role in enhancing the user experience by providing precise control over various electronic systems. These devices are primarily used in automotive dashboards, steering controls, seat adjustments, climate control systems, and infotainment systems, ensuring smooth and accurate operation. The growing trend of electrification in vehicles and the increasing integration of advanced electronics for safety and comfort features have led to a rise in the demand for rocker potentiometers. Their reliability, long life, and resistance to vibrations make them ideal for automotive environments, further propelling their adoption in modern vehicles.
Additionally, rocker potentiometers are crucial for facilitating driver interface control and assisting in the development of autonomous driving technologies. As electric and autonomous vehicles continue to gain traction in China, the demand for high-quality and efficient control components, such as rocker potentiometers, will further increase. With their ability to provide tactile feedback and support precise adjustments, these devices are becoming indispensable for the automotive industry’s ongoing technological advancements, including in electric vehicle (EV) control systems, where precision and reliability are paramount.
In the aerospace sector, rocker potentiometers are used in various applications where precision and reliability are of utmost importance. These devices are typically incorporated into flight control systems, cockpit instrumentation, and avionics, helping to maintain accurate control of aircraft systems. The aerospace industry in China has been experiencing significant growth, fueled by the government’s investment in expanding the domestic aviation market and the rise of aerospace technology companies. As a result, the demand for high-performance rocker potentiometers is expected to increase, as they are critical in providing accurate adjustments in highly sensitive and critical systems, such as navigation and communication devices in aircraft.
Rocker potentiometers in aerospace applications must adhere to strict standards of durability and performance. The devices need to function reliably in extreme environmental conditions such as high altitudes, temperature fluctuations, and vibrations. This makes the ability to withstand harsh conditions a key factor driving the use of rocker potentiometers in aerospace systems. As China’s aerospace industry continues to grow, particularly in commercial aviation and space exploration, the demand for sophisticated and high-quality electronic components like rocker potentiometers is anticipated to rise significantly, creating long-term opportunities for manufacturers in the market.
The communication sector in China is rapidly evolving, with the growth of 5G networks, smart devices, and broadband technologies creating new opportunities for rocker potentiometers. These components are used in a wide range of communication devices, such as routers, modems, and network switches, where precise control of signal strength, frequency tuning, and volume adjustments is essential. As the demand for high-speed internet and reliable communication networks continues to grow in China, the need for effective electronic control systems using rocker potentiometers becomes even more critical.
Rocker potentiometers offer the precision necessary to control complex electronic circuits in communication equipment, ensuring optimal performance in systems that require frequent adjustments or fine-tuning. Additionally, as China focuses on expanding its 5G infrastructure, rocker potentiometers will play a key role in ensuring the smooth operation of next-generation communication devices. This presents a significant growth opportunity for manufacturers, as they supply rocker potentiometers for increasingly sophisticated communication technologies that demand high levels of precision and dependability.
Beyond automotive, aerospace, and communication sectors, rocker potentiometers are used across various other applications, including industrial automation, medical devices, home appliances, and consumer electronics. In industrial settings, they are crucial for controlling machinery, robotics, and process control systems, where precise adjustments of electrical parameters are required to ensure operational efficiency. Their ruggedness, long lifespan, and ability to function accurately in tough environments make them ideal for use in industrial machinery and factory automation systems.
In the medical device industry, rocker potentiometers are used in equipment such as diagnostic machines, monitoring systems, and surgical instruments, where precision is vital. The versatility and adaptability of rocker potentiometers across different sectors contribute significantly to their widespread adoption. As technology continues to advance in various industries, the demand for reliable, precise control devices like rocker potentiometers is expected to rise across the board, opening up new opportunities for growth and innovation in diverse fields.
